Antonio Rudiger, in an exclusive interview with TNT Sports, acknowledged that Real Madrid will be seeking “revenge” in their upcoming UEFA Champions League quarter-final clash against Manchester City. This comes after City’s victory over Real in last year’s competition, which led them to secure their first European Cup. The first leg of this anticipated rematch will take place at the Santiago Bernabeu on Tuesday evening, with memories of the 4-0 thrashing Real suffered at the Etihad Stadium still fresh in their minds.

Reflecting on last year’s defeat, Rudiger admitted that it was a tough moment for the team and that there is a desire for revenge this time around. He highlighted the respect both teams have for each other’s rich histories and the quality of players on both sides. Rudiger emphasized the importance of staying focused on multiple threats aside from Erling Haaland, as demonstrated by City’s performance in the previous matches. Real Madrid boasts a talented roster of young players, including Jude Bellingham, Vinicius Jr., Eduardo Camavinga, and Rodrygo, who play pivotal roles under Carlo Ancelotti.

Real Madrid, currently leading La Liga by six points and well-rested after a nine-day break, are aiming for a treble this season, having already secured the Supercopa de Espana. Despite their success in domestic competitions, Champions League glory remains the ultimate goal for the club and its supporters. Rudiger acknowledges the weight of expectations at Real Madrid, with the club having won the European Cup 14 times previously. He emphasized the importance of attention to detail and luck in high-stakes matches like the upcoming clash against Manchester City.
